khoj/documentation/assets/img
sabaimran a53178cab9
Add developer support for using next.js to serve generated static files (#814)
To improve the developer experience for front-end development, we're migrating to Next.js. In order to do this migration page-by-page, we're using static site generation via Next.js. This also helps us avoid making cross site requests from front-end to back-end for the time being, while giving a ramp to separating out server and client if needed for scale down the road.

Dev instructions for using the next.js setup are in the added README.

This adds scaffolding for including the built files in the python package as well as the docker images. Docker setup has been tested locally. In order to verify the build is working as expected, we can navigate to the {khoj_host}:42110/experimental and verify that the experiment page comes up.

This setup works with serving static files included in the src/interface/web folder from the Django app. The key bit for understanding the setup is in the yarn export command in package.json.
2024-06-22 20:12:41 +05:30
..
admin_get_emali_login.png Add support for magic link email sign-in (#820) 2024-06-20 13:32:58 +05:30
admin_successful_login_url.png Add support for magic link email sign-in (#820) 2024-06-20 13:32:58 +05:30
dream_house.png Add more demo videos, images, add feature sections 2024-03-30 14:48:46 +05:30
favicon-128x128.ico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j-logo-sideways-200.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j-logo-sideways-500.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j-logo-sideways.svg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_architecture.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_chat_on_desktop.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_chat_on_emacs.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_chat_on_obsidian.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_chat_on_web.png Make some basic updates to the chat documentation. Inc. conversation file filters, new screenshot 2024-06-18 12:14:59 +05:30
khoj_clients.svg Use Khoj Client, Data sources diagrams in feature docs 2024-01-08 01:58:57 +05:30
khoj_codebase_visualization_0.2.1.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_datasources.svg Use Khoj Client, Data sources diagrams in feature docs 2024-01-08 01:58:57 +05:30
khoj_emacs_menu.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_obsidian_codebase_visualization_0.2.1.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_pwa_android.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_search_on_desktop.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_search_on_emacs.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_search_on_obsidian.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
khoj_search_on_web.png Migrate to using docusaurus, rather than docsify for documentation (#603) 2024-01-07 20:28:15 +05:30
magic_link.png Add support for magic link email sign-in (#820) 2024-06-20 13:32:58 +05:30
plants_i_got.png Add more demo videos, images, add feature sections 2024-03-30 14:48:46 +05:30
pwa_install_1.png Document installing Khoj on Phone as a Progressive Web App (PWA) 2024-03-08 21:18:06 +05:30
pwa_install_2.png Document installing Khoj on Phone as a Progressive Web App (PWA) 2024-03-08 21:18:06 +05:30
pwa_install_3.png Document installing Khoj on Phone as a Progressive Web App (PWA) 2024-03-08 21:18:06 +05:30
select_file_filter.png Make some basic updates to the chat documentation. Inc. conversation file filters, new screenshot 2024-06-18 12:14:59 +05:30
summarize.jpg Add Documentation for the /summarize Command (#822) 2024-06-20 12:08:01 +05:30
using_khoj_for_studying.gif Add more demo videos, images, add feature sections 2024-03-30 14:48:46 +05:30